The Denman Charitable Trust is a family grant-making charity that historically provides grants for smaller Bristol charities. It also funds small charities in Bath and North-East Somerset and South Gloucestershire.
The Trust supports a diverse range of charitable causes, although its main focus is on charities working in the areas of health and disability.
Awards range from £1,000 to £5,000, with an average award of around £2,000.
Details of recently awarded grants can be viewed on the Trust’s website.
Applications may be made at any time and will be considered at a quarterly trustee meetings, usually in March, June, September and December each year.
